Understanding the Core Mechanics of a Battery Bet

A battery bet, at its foundation, is an accumulator wager where each selection must win for the bet to be successful. The odds of each selection are multiplied together to determine the overall odds of the bet. This can lead to substantial returns from a relatively small stake. However, it’s important to remember that if even one selection loses, the entire bet is lost. This all-or-nothing nature is what differentiates it from other bet types. The appeal lies in the potential for exponential gains, turning a modest investment into a significant payout.

The number of selections within a battery bet can vary widely, from a simple double (two selections) to complexes involving ten or more. As the number of selections increases, so does the potential payout, but also the associated risk. Careful consideration of each selection is paramount, and understanding the individual probabilities is vital for assessing the overall viability of the bet. Utilizing statistical analysis and in-depth knowledge of the sports involved is key to spotting value.

Strategically Selecting Your Components

Constructing a successful battery bet isn’t merely about picking what you think will win; it’s about identifying value and correlations. Value betting involves finding selections where the odds offered by the bookmaker suggest a higher probability of winning than the event realistically presents. This requires a thorough understanding of form, statistics, and any influencing factors like team news or weather conditions. Focusing on niche sports or leagues where bookmakers may have less in-depth knowledge can also reveal valuable opportunities.

Correlating selections is another vital aspect. This involves choosing selections that are statistically likely to occur together. For example, if you believe a strong attacking team is likely to win a match with over 2.5 goals scored, combining these two selections into a battery bet exploits the correlation. Avoid including selections that are negatively correlated—events where one outcome diminishes the probability of the other. The Importance of Stake Management

Given the inherent risk associated with battery bets, diligent stake management is non-negotiable. Avoid allocating a substantial portion of your betting bank to a single accumulator. A common approach is to limit your stake to a small percentage—typically between 1% and 5%—of your total bankroll. This helps to mitigate potential losses and ensures long-term sustainability. It’s crucial to view battery betting as a high-risk, high-reward segment of your overall betting strategy, and allocate funds accordingly. Remember, consistency and discipline are essential for long-term success.

Furthermore, consider employing a unit staking system where each bet represents a uniform unit size. This allows you to track your profit and loss more effectively and adjust your stakes based on your performance. A losing streak shouldn’t prompt you to recklessly increase your stakes in an attempt to recoup losses—this is a common mistake that can quickly deplete your bankroll. Instead, stick to your pre-defined stake limits and maintain a disciplined approach. Understanding your risk tolerance is paramount.

Leveraging Different Sports for Battery Bets

The suitability of the battery bet approach varies across different sports. Football (soccer) is a particularly popular choice due to the numerous betting markets available, including match results, over/under goals, both teams to score, and correct scores. These markets provide ample opportunities for combining selections and creating well-correlated accumulator bets. However, the unpredictable nature of football also means that upsets are common, increasing the risk.

Tennis also lends itself well to battery bets, particularly when focusing on match winners and over/under games played. Basketball, with its high scoring nature, provides opportunities for betting on point spreads and totals. Even seemingly less predictable sports like darts or snooker can be exploited for battery bets if you possess in-depth knowledge of the players and their form. The key is to identify sports where you have a genuine edge and can consistently assess probabilities accurately.

Utilizing Promotions and Enhanced Odds

Many bookmakers frequently offer promotions and enhanced odds specifically designed for accumulator bets. These promotions can significantly increase your potential returns. Be aware of ‘accumulator boosts’ that increase the odds on successful accumulators, or ‘money-back specials’ that refund your stake if one selection lets you down. Always read the terms and conditions carefully, as these promotions often come with specific requirements and restrictions.

Furthermore, shopping around for the best odds across different bookmakers can also make a substantial difference. Even a small difference in odds can have a compounding effect when multiplied across multiple selections. Utilizing odds comparison websites can save you time and effort in identifying the most favorable odds available.
